                  followed this to the letter

                  1. Plug in the box and connect the cables
                  2.Format a usb stick in pc to fat32
                  3.Copy the firmware onto the stick via the PC.
                  4 Switch your box off completely and insert the usb in the rear socket.
                  5.Switch on the box wait for it to boot up.
                  6.Press menu and scroll to usb press ok
                  7.The firmware should start to transfer from the usb to the box.
                  8.Once this has done hit menu and key in 1570 with the remote.
                  this will bring up the secret menu hi light keycode and change it to on.
                  9.You should now be set to scan go into menu and select installation,choose automatic scan press ok then choose your provider hit ok again.
                  You should now get all channels your after.
                  If by any chance you dont get the channels try a different provider.
